RIST is the\u00a0general incorporated foundation\u00a0that is responsible for the promotion of\u00a0the\u00a0shared use of Japan\u2019s collective supercomputing resources across the entire country, including those of the supercomputer<em>\u00a0Fugaku<\/em>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The agreement which was signed between RIST and NSCC is a milestone for both organizations. The agreement builds on an earlier Memorandum of Understanding on\u00a0Information Exchange Concerning Promotion of Supercomputer Utilization\u00a0between RIST and NSCC.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Since its debut in June 2020,&nbsp;<em>Fugaku<\/em>&nbsp;has retained its ranking as the reigning top supercomputer in the world in the latest November 2021 issue of the global TOP500 supercomputer list. With an amazing 442 PFLOPS of compute power,&nbsp;<em>Fugaku<\/em>&nbsp;is about three times more powerful than its closest competitor.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The annual Call for Projects to\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0via NSCC and RIST will be in addition to NSCC\u2019s national Call for Projects, which is already held every six months for all Singapore-based research projects. The additional access to\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0will give Singapore researchers more options for resources to meet their high-performance computing (HPC) needs. Singapore researchers will also have upgraded national HPC resources to tap on when Singapore\u2019s newest supercomputer system, with an aggregated raw, compute power of up to 10 PFLOPS, comes online in the first half of 2022.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.revoscience.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Key-Principals-of-Organisations-Involved-675x326.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-21760\" width=\"840\" height=\"406\" title=\"\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.revoscience.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Key-Principals-of-Organisations-Involved-675x326.jpg 675w, https:\/\/www.revoscience.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Key-Principals-of-Organisations-Involved-768x371.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.revoscience.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Key-Principals-of-Organisations-Involved-228x110.jpg 228w, https:\/\/www.revoscience.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Key-Principals-of-Organisations-Involved.jpg 906w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 840px) 100vw, 840px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cThe trial access to\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0last year garnered keen interest from Singapore research teams,\u201d said Associate Professor Tan Tin Wee, Chief Executive of NSCC explaining that a total of eight research teams had applied for resources via the\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0Preliminary Use Projects, out of which six projects were approved for resources. The approved Singapore projects covered COVID-related biomedical research, cancer research, and materials science research.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"> \u201cNSCC\u2019s new partnership with RIST will ensure that Singapore researchers have a regular path to access\u00a0<em>Fugaku\u2019s<\/em>\u00a0ARM chip-based architecture and compute power. Tapping on such resources helps broaden the experience of the Singapore HPC community by getting access to CPU and interconnect technologies which are not available in Singapore. This collaboration between the HPC organizations of Singapore and Japan further cements our already established links and contributes to the development of the high-performance computing field in both countries.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>\u201c<\/strong>Singapore is placed as one of the leading countries in the HPC field in Asia Oceania,\u201d\u00a0said Dr\u00a0Hideyuki Takatsu, Managing Director of RIST, adding that RIST has enjoyed close cooperation with NSCC since its inception. \u201cOur agreement with NSCC, which allows Singapore researchers to apply for accessible\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0resources through NSCC and RIST, is a new step to expanding international\u00a0<em>Fugaku<\/em>\u00a0utilization. I believe that this will promote international cooperative research and worldwide dissemination of Japanese application software and\u00a0<em>Fugaku\u2019s<\/em>\u00a0ARM chip-based architecture.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cWe have been collaborating with NSCC for some time formulating a relationship as national supercomputing centers of respective nations,\u201d&nbsp;said Prof Satoshi Matsuoka, Director of&nbsp;RIKEN Center for Computational Science (R-CCS). \u201cWe are delighted with this new MoU agreement between NSCC and RIST, in that we can further extend this now trilateral collaboration to bring forth unprecedented supercomputing capabilities to the researchers in Singapore.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The new Call for Projects to&nbsp;<em>Fugaku<\/em>&nbsp;will be launched in Singapore in December 2021.&nbsp;Upon approval,&nbsp;the first projects can expect to start using the&nbsp;<em>Fugaku<\/em>&nbsp;system from April 2022. The maximum amount of&nbsp;<em>Fugaku<\/em>&nbsp;resources available to Singapore researchers annually will be capped at 1M Node Hours (NH), or about 5 research projects, with a maximum duration of one year for each project to use the approved resources.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Singapore researchers will be amongst
